/* CSS Document */

body{
	font-size:12px;
	line-height:1.8em;
	color:#555;
	font-family:"微软雅黑";
	background:url(../images/bg.png) no-repeat center top #fff;
	}
body,h1,h2,h3,h4,h5,h6,hr,p,blockquote,dl,dt,dd,ul,ol,li,pre,form,fieldset,legend,button,input,textarea,th,td{
	margin:0;padding:0;
	}
	
	img { bord
input, textarea, select{
	font-family:"微软雅黑";
	font-size:12px;
    }

    }
ul{
    margin:0px; padding:0px; list-style-type:none;
}
li{list-style:none;}
.l{float:left;}
.r{float:right;}
.c{clear:both;}
a{color:#000;text-decoration:none;}	
none;}	
a:hover{color:#BC2821;text-decoration:none;}

.jbgr tr{ line-height:40px;}

.jbgr tr input{ border:solid 1px #cccccc; height:25px;}
.top{width: 1000px;height: 255px;margin:0 auto;}


.all{width: 1000px;height: auto;margin:0 auto;}


.siderbar{width: 255px;height: 564px;}
.siderbar ul{margin:40px 0 0 40px;}
.siderbar ul li{width: 215px;height: 47px;margin-bottom: 20px;}


.footer{width: 1000px;margin:0 auto;height: 150px;}
.footer p{text-align: center;font-size: 14px;color: #890202;line-height: 25px;padding-top: 40px;}

.content{width: 745px;height: auto;}
.content_header{width: 1000px;height: 9px;background:;}
.content_bottom{width: 1000px;height: 9px;background:;clear:both;}
.content_c{width: 1000px;height: auto;background:;clear: both;min-height:570px;padding-bottom:20px;}


.link1 li{  float:left; margin-right:25px;}
.link1 li a{ font-size:16px; color: #333}

.h1_header{background: url(../images/h1_header.png) no-repeat;width: 425px;height: 30px;margin: 60px auto 40px;}




.h1_header{background: url(../images/h1_header.png) no-repeat;width: 425px;height: 30px;margin: 60px auto 40px;}




.h1_header{background: url(../images/h1_header.png) no-repeat;width: 425px;height: 30px;margin: 60px auto 40px;}
.hy{color: #353535;font-size: 16px;padding:0 40px;text-indent: 2em;text-align: justify;line-height: 35px;}
.z{color: #353535;font-size: 16px;text-align: justify;line-height: 80px;padding-left: 40px;height: 80px;}
.index_btn_group{width: 330px;height: 40px;margin: 60px auto 0;line-height: 40px;}
.index_btn_group ul{width: 370px;}
.index_btn_group ul li{width: 145px; float: left;margin-right: 40px;}


h2{margin: 40px auto 40px;color: #b81b05;font-size: 18px;text-align: center;border-bottom: 1px solid #b81b05;padding: 0 40px;width: 580px;height: 45px;line-height: 45px;letter-spacing: 3px;}


.fg_list{width: 660px;margin: 0 auto;}
.fg_list li{height: 33px;line-height: 33px;background: url(../images/li.jpg) no-repeat left center;padding-left: 15px;}
.fg_list li a{color: #333;font-size: 14px;}
.fg_list li a span{float: right;}
.fg_list li a:hover{color:#b81b05}


.link{width: 660px;margin: 0 auto;}
.link li{float: left;margin-right: 20px;}
.link li a{font-size: 14px;}


.jbxz{width: 660px;margin: 0 auto;}
.jbxz li{float: left;margin-right: 20px;line-height: 30px;font-size: 14px;color:#000;}
.jbxz li a{}


.ty{width: 660px;margin:0 auto;font-size: 14px;margin-top: 10px;color:#000;}


.jb_btn_group{width: 300px;height: 39px;margin: 30px auto 0;line-height: 39px;}
.jb_btn_group ul{width: 472px;}
.jb_btn_group ul li{width: 196px; float: left;margin-right: 40px;}



.page { width: 100%; text-align:center;}
.page a { padding: 5px 10px; background-color: #f2f2f2; color: #333; font-size: 14px; margin: 0 1px;}
.page a:hover,.page .on { background-color: #b81b05; color:#FFFFFF}